Для определения мощности алфавита, необходимо найти количество различных символов, которые могут использоваться для кодирования сообщения.
У нас есть сообщение, содержащее 2048 символов, и объем этого сообщения составляет 1.25 Кбайтов. Зная, что 1 Кбайт равен 1024 байтам, мы можем вычислить количество бит, используемых для кодирования сообщения:
1.25 Кбайт * 1024 бит = 1280 бит
Теперь мы можем определить мощность алфавита. Пусть n будет количество различных символов в алфавите, тогда мощность алфавита будет равна 2^n. Мы знаем, что для кодирования 2048 символов используется 1280 бит, и можно предположить, что каждый символ кодируется на n бит:
2048 символов * n бит = 1280 бит
n = 1280 бит / 2048 символов = 0.625 бит на символ
Таким образом, мощность алфавита для данного случая равна 2^0.625 ≈ 1.59, то есть округленно 2 символа. Другими словами, для кодирования сообщения, содержащего 2048 символов и занимающего 1.25 Кбайтов, требуется использование алфавита, состоящего из 2 различных символов.
Для определения мощности алфавита, необходимо найти количество различных символов, которые могут использоваться для кодирования сообщения.
У нас есть сообщение, содержащее 2048 символов, и объем этого сообщения составляет 1.25 Кбайтов. Зная, что 1 Кбайт равен 1024 байтам, мы можем вычислить количество бит, используемых для кодирования сообщения:
1.25 Кбайт * 1024 бит = 1280 бит
Теперь мы можем определить мощность алфавита. Пусть n будет количество различных символов в алфавите, тогда мощность алфавита будет равна 2^n. Мы знаем, что для кодирования 2048 символов используется 1280 бит, и можно предположить, что каждый символ кодируется на n бит:
2048 символов * n бит = 1280 бит
n = 1280 бит / 2048 символов = 0.625 бит на символ
Таким образом, мощность алфавита для данного случая равна 2^0.625 ≈ 1.59, то есть округленно 2 символа. Другими словами, для кодирования сообщения, содержащего 2048 символов и занимающего 1.25 Кбайтов, требуется использование алфавита, состоящего из 2 различных символов.